Ball


SizeClass     Circumference (cm)   Weight (g)
IIIMen and male over-16s59–60  425–475
IIWomen, male over-12s, and female over-14s54–56  325–375
IOver-8s50–52   290–330
A size III handball.

The ball is spherical and must be made either of leather or a synthetic material. It is not allowed to have a shiny or slippery surface. As the ball is intended to be operated by a single hand, its official sizes vary depending on age and gender of the participating teams.

















Resin product used to improve ball handling.

Though this is not officially regulated, the ball is usually resinated. The resin improves the ability of the players to manipulate the ball with a single hand, as in spinning trick shots. Some indoor arenas prohibit the usage of resin, since many products leave sticky stains on the floor.
